Weather in January

The first month of the year in Save, Benin is marked by warm weather with a temperature high of 37.3°C (99.1°F). January is also fairly dry, with less rainfall and fewer rainy days compared to the upcoming months. The humidity is also comparatively lower, making it a comfortable time to visit. This month is characterized by abundant sunlight and clear skies. As an added bonus, visibility extends up to 9km (5.6mi) on average, ideal for those wishing to explore the surrounding areas.

Temperature

As January takes hold, the average high-temperature is a still sweltering 37.3°C (99.1°F), nearly mirroring that of the previous month. Nightly average temperatures in January reveal a significant dip from daytime highs in Save, registering a consistent an agreeable 22.5°C (72.5°F).

Heat index

In January, the average heat index is computed to be a life-threatening hot 48°C (118.4°F). Attention: Heat exhaustion and heat cramps are anticipated. Prolonged effort can result in heatstroke.
Records show heat index calculations are tailored for shaded regions and mild winds. A direct sunlight exposure may boost the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'felt air temperature', is a measure that combines air temperature and relative humidity into a single value that indicates how hot the weather feels. The impression of weather on a person can be swayed by additional aspects, including metabolic variations, pregnancy, and activity levels. Being under direct sunshine can magnify the heat experience, possibly pushing up the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are largely significant for babies and toddlers. Children often lack awareness of the importance of taking breaks and rehydrating. The feeling of thirst is a late indication of dehydration, so maintaining hydration, especially during long periods of physical activity, is critical.
To offset high temperatures, the human body releases sweat which, upon evaporation, cools it down. When there is an excess of moisture in the atmosphere, the efficiency of the evaporation process is lessened, leading to less efficient body cooling and a sensation of overheating. Elevated heat gain compared to the body's release capability poses risks of dehydration and potential overheating.

Humidity

The least humid month is January, with an average relative humidity of 53%.

Rainfall

In Save, in January, it is raining for 4.3 days, with typically 6mm (0.24") of accumulated precipitation. In Save, during the entire year, the rain falls for 207.1 days and collects up to 739mm (29.09") of precipitation.

Daylight

In January, the average length of the day in Save, Benin, is 11h and 43min.
On the first day of January in Save, Benin, sunrise is at 07:03 and sunset at 18:43.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 07:09 and sunset at 18:56 WAT.

Sunshine

In Save, Benin, the average sunshine in January is 9.8h.

UV index

The average daily maximum UV index in January is 7.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high threat to health from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
